The Return Cost Insurance / Trust helps foreign workers cover expenses when returning home after their contract ends.It also aims to prevent illegal stays after the visa period expires.
Who must join and when
Visa types: E-9 (Non-professional Employment) and H-2 (Working Visit)
Enrollment deadline: Within 3 months from the effective date of your labor contract
Effective date depends on your visa status:
E-9: Date of first entry into Korea
H-2: First day of work
Workplace change: Start date of the new labor contract
Re-employment: Day after previous employment period ends
Re-entry special case: Day after being handed over to the new employer
Payment amount
Category | Nationality | Amount |
|---|---|---|
Group 1 | China, Philippines, Indonesia, Thailand, Vietnam | 400,000 KRW |
Group 2 | Mongolia | 500,000 KRW |
Group 3 | Sri Lanka | 600,000 KRW |
Others | All other countries | 500,000 KRW |
When you can claim the payment
Returning home after visa expiration
Returning home before visa expiration for personal reasons
Voluntary departure or deportation after leaving the workplace
Important notes
You must claim within 3 years after the qualifying event
Failure to join may result in a fine of up to 5 million KRW

Accident Insurance is designed to cover illness or death not caused by work-related accidents.
Who must join and when
Visa types: E-9, H-2
Enrollment deadline: Within 15 days from the effective date of your labor contract
When you can claim the payment
Death due to illness or injury
Permanent disability due to illness or injury
Note: Hospital treatment costs for minor injuries are not covered.If the incident is work-related, it is covered by Industrial Accident Compensation Insurance, not Accident Insurance.
Important notes
Failure to join may result in a fine of up to 5 million KRW

In addition to the insurances that foreign workers must join, there are insurances that the employer is required to provide:
Departure Guarantee Insurance
Helps employers manage the lump-sum payment of retirement allowances when workers leave.
Wage Payment Guarantee Insurance
Protects against unpaid wages.
Failure to enroll in these will also result in a fine of up to 5 million KRW for the employer.
